Wind driven generator control system

2010 
The invention discloses a wind driven generator control system based on DSP+MCU+FPGA, which is suitable for controlling a double-fed wind driven generator converter of 1.5MW. A digital signal processor DSP utilizes strong data arithmetic capability to realize the function of large quantity data operation of the converter; a microprogrammed computer unit MCU utilizes abundant internal resource to realize the protection and communication functions of the converter; a filed programmable gate array FPGA utilizes abundant I/O pins and convenient expandability to realize the functions of PWM signal output and switch in-out signal extension management of the converter. The MCU and the FPGA are communicated by a local bus interface, and a watchdog function is designed to monitor mutual operation state. The design fully satisfies the requirements of the current wind driven generator converter, and greatly improves the expandability and the reliability of the converter.
